Diaper Creams
Even with high-quality, ultra-absorbent diapers comes the opportunity for a diaper rash. These rashes that cause a baby’s bottom to turn red, hot, or bumpy are often either caused by moisture or friction from a diaper. The best way to combat this is with a quality diaper cream that creates a barrier between the skin and the diaper and moisture within. It can be used with every diaper change—no need to wait until a rash appears! There are endless creams on the market, but these are tried and true and editor-approved.

Diaper Pails
Diaper pails are the most functional of ‘luxury purchases’ and will definitely add additional sanitary benefits to any diaper station. While, like a trash can, we can toss dirty diapers in them, diaper pails are specifically designed to prevent odors from escaping. Plus, many come with foot pedals or lids easy to open with one hand.
